DescriptionRolling sphere planimeter in a rectangular, wooden box. Planimeter consists of a long metal tracer arm with a stylus on the end, attached to a black metal frame containing two silver wheels. The tracer arm is attached to the frame by a clamp and a spring. On top of the frame, between the two wheels, is a metal bar. There is a white plastic dial, displaying the numbers 1-45 in intervals of five, on top of the end of the bar closest to the tracer arm. A white plastic vernier scale is wrapped around the other end of the bar. The rounded edge of a hemispherical piece of metal is in contact with the side of the bar. There are several objects not attached to the planimeter: a graduated, adjustable metal bar [an extension to the tracer arm?], a shorter, flat metal bar, a metal bar with a square cross-section, a brass roller with hooks on either side, and a small brush.
The inside of the box is felt. There are three pieces of paper attached to the inside of the lid. The top one contains a four-column table with the printed headings "Scales/Position of the vernier on the tracer bar/Value of the unit of the vernier on the measuring roller/Constant." The values are filled into the table by hand, the "Constant" column left blank. At the bottom of the table, "Zurich, the 12 Februar. 1907. No. 2232. G Coradi," is written, the date and the no. written in by hand.
Below the table are instructions typed in German. To the left of the German instructions is a typed translation that reads as follows: "(translation of instructions) / to take the instrument from the case, hold it with the right hand on the large frame, never by the frame of the measuring roller, and with the left hand hold the tracer arm. Lift carefully from the case without the use of force with the left hand." In handwriting it is written, at the top of the card: "To read sq. inches, set vernier on 3258."
